Exercise Science and Kinesiology is the 25th most popular major in the country with 31,165 degrees awarded in 2019-2020.

Across Michigan, there were 1,355 exercise science and kinesiology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 1,268 exercise science and kinesiology graduates with average earnings and debt of $40,161 and $25,915 respectively.

This year’s “Best Value Exercise Science Schools for a Bachelor’s in Michigan For Those Making $0-$30k” ranking looked at 17 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in exercise science and kinesiology. This ranking identifies schools with high-quality exercise science and kinesiology programs that also have a lower cost than schools of similar quality.

When determining these rankings, we looked at things such as overall quality of the exercise science and kinesiology program at the school and the cost to attend the school once aid has been awarded. See our ranking methodology to learn more.

Top 17 Best Value Bachelor’s Degree Colleges for Exercise Science and Kinesiology (Income $0-$30k) in Michigan

#1 in overall quality

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of Michigan - Ann Arbor.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Exercise Science Schools for a Bachelor’s in Michigan For Those Making $0-$30k. University of Michigan - Ann Arbor is located in Ann Arbor, Michigan and, has a large student population. In 2019-2020, this school awarded 128 bachelors’s exercise science degrees to qualified students.

As a testament to the quality of education offered at U-M, the school also landed the #1 spot in our “Best Exercise Science and Kinesiology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Michigan” ranking. It costs about $3,166 for Michigan Bachelor’s Degree Exercise Science students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end U-M.

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 96%. The low student loan default rate of 1.2%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%.

#3

Michigan State University

East Lansing, Michigan
#2 in overall quality

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Michigan State University. The school came in at #3 for the Best Value Exercise Science Schools for a Bachelor’s in Michigan For Those Making $0-$30k. East Lansing, Michigan is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out bachelors’s exercise science degrees to 339 students in 2019-2020.

Michigan State did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#2 on our “Best Exercise Science and Kinesiology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Michigan” list. It costs about $6,686 for Michigan Bachelor’s Degree Exercise Science students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end Michigan State University.

The low student loan default rate of 3.6%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 91%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.
